What Topics will the Workshop Entail?

01

Identifying and understanding emotions, including learning about internal body cues and connecting them to the emotions you're feeling.  

02

Identifying healthy and unhealthy emotional responses.

03

Learning about the inner critic and positive self-talk.

04

Strategies for improving frustration tolerance, impulsivity, sharing, and turn taking skills. 

05

Understanding co-regulation skills, setting boundaries, and providing expectations. 

06

Increasing awareness on how sleep, exercise, food, sunlight, screens, and sensory needs affect emotional regulation.
